Nipuni Wasana wins beach wrestling gold at the Asian Beach Games in China, bringing pride to Sri Lanka and Mission Olympic.
Nipuni Wasana brought glory to Sri Lanka after winning the gold medal in the Women’s 50kg Beach Wrestling event at the 6th Asian Beach Games held in Sanya, China.
The brave Sri Lankan athlete, who adorned Mother Lanka with gold through her historic performance, arrived in the country last night (01) after her outstanding victory on the international stage.
She received a warm welcome at the Katunayake International Airport, where officials from the Ministry of Youth Affairs and Sports, officials from the Department of Sports Development, representatives of the National Olympic Committee of Sri Lanka, senior Air Force Officers, and others were present.
Nipuni’s gold medal came after she defeated the Vietnamese athlete in a tense final match. The victory added fresh pride to Sri Lanka’s sports history and gave the country another moment of international recognition.
